What eligibility requirements exist for submitting the Florida Condominium Lease Application?
Typically, both lessees and owners must provide valid identification and be eligible under the condominium association rules, including any age or financial criteria.
Is there a deadline for submitting the Florida Condominium Lease Application?
While there may not be a strict deadline, it is advisable to submit the application as early as possible to ensure an efficient leasing process, particularly during high-demand periods.
How can I submit the completed Florida Condominium Lease Application?
You can submit the application directly through pdfFiller by following their submission guidelines, or print and deliver it to the owner or condominium association.
What supporting documents are required with the Florida Condominium Lease Application?
Generally, accompanying documents may include proof of income, identification, and any previous rental history, depending on the association's requirements.
What are common mistakes to avoid when filling out the application?
Common mistakes include neglecting to fill out all required fields, providing inaccurate information, and failing to sign the document. Double-check all entries for accuracy.
What is the typical processing time for the application?
Processing times vary, but you can expect a response within a few days to a week, depending on the association’s procedures and workload.
Are there any fees associated with the Florida Condominium Lease Application?
While the application itself may not have fees, condominium associations might charge administrative fees or deposits during the application process, so it’s wise to confirm with them.
